Driveway Drainage Repair in Tuscaloosa, AL
Driveway drainage repair involves fixing issues related to the proper flow and management of water on residential driveways. This service typically addresses problems such as pooling water, uneven surfaces caused by erosion, or water runoff that threatens the stability of the driveway and surrounding property. Projects may include installing or restoring drainage channels, repairing or replacing damaged slopes, and ensuring that water is directed away from the foundation and other critical areas. Property owners often seek these repairs to prevent water damage, reduce the risk of driveway cracking, and maintain safe, functional access to their homes.
Before requesting driveway drainage repair, property owners usually want to understand the extent of the water-related issues and the best solutions for their specific property. It’s important to assess whether the problem is caused by poor initial grading, clogged drains, or other underlying factors. Clear communication about the current driveway condition, the history of drainage problems, and desired outcomes can help determine the most effective repair approach. Proper drainage is essential for preserving the driveway’s integrity and protecting the property from water-related damage.

Common Driveway Drainage Repair Jobs
Driveway Drainage Repair - fixes pooling and water runoff issues that can damage the driveway surface.
Drainage System Installation - adds or replaces drainage solutions to improve water flow away from the driveway.
Crack and Hole Repair - addresses cracks and holes caused by poor drainage or shifting ground.
Slope Correction - adjusts the driveway slope to ensure proper water runoff and prevent pooling.
Drainage Channel Repair - restores or installs channels to direct water away from the driveway effectively.
Erosion Control - implements measures to prevent soil erosion around the driveway caused by inadequate drainage.
Driveway Drainage Repair Questions
What causes driveway drainage problems? Common causes include poor grading, clogged gutters, and compacted soil that prevent proper water runoff.
How can drainage issues affect a driveway? Water accumulation can lead to cracks, erosion, and uneven surfaces over time.
What are typical driveway drainage repair solutions? Solutions often involve regrading, installing drains, or adding gravel to improve water flow.
When is driveway drainage repair needed? Repairs are needed when standing water, erosion, or cracks appear, indicating drainage problems.
